When deciding how to choose the proper roofing type in your residence, varied components come into play that may considerably influence both aesthetic appeal and performance. The roofing fashion contributes to the overall character of the property and may improve its curb appeal.


Start by contemplating the architectural style of your home. Different homes, similar to ranch-style, colonial, or modern, may be complemented by explicit roofing designs. For instance, a steeply pitched roof often pairs nicely with traditional houses, permitting for efficient water drainage and snow shedding. Alternatively, a flat roof is more suitable for modern houses and can offer a modern aesthetic that appeals to some homeowners.


Climate also performs a crucial position in roofing selection. In areas with heavy snowfall, a steeper roof can forestall snow accumulation, thus minimizing potential injury. Conversely, flat roofs may perform better in hotter climates the place rainwater drainage is much less of a priority. Understanding native climate patterns might help guide your choice to ensure sturdiness and longevity.

Material choice is equally important when contemplating roofing types. Asphalt shingles are in style for his or her affordability and ease of set up, while metal roofing offers longevity and sturdiness. Options corresponding to slate and tile can add class and charm, but they typically come with the next price tag and require specialized installation.


Consider the upkeep necessities of different roofing styles and materials. Some may require extra maintenance, corresponding to common cleaning or repairs, whereas others are identified for their low maintenance needs. A flat roof, for example, could require extra frequent inspections to forestall water pooling, whereas metal roofs tend to be extra resilient and require fewer repairs.


Another aspect to keep in mind is vitality effectivity. Some roofing materials are designed to mirror daylight and reduce warmth absorption. This can result in lower energy prices and a extra comfy residing environment. Cool roofing materials are more and more popular for owners trying to cut back their carbon footprint while having fun with long-term financial savings.

Local building codes and regulations can influence your roofing selection as nicely. Certain areas might have restrictions on specific materials and designs, especially in historic districts. Understanding and adhering to these codes ensures that your home remains compliant whereas nonetheless showcasing your private type.


Insurance concerns are another factor to bear in mind. Some roofing materials could qualify for discounts on homeowner’s insurance coverage, particularly these which would possibly be fire-resistant or deemed more durable towards weather-related damage. Consulting along with your insurance provider might help you make informed selections that profit your monetary bottom line.


Cost is, undoubtedly, a serious consideration in choosing a roofing fashion. While some might opt for the extra economical choice in hopes of saving money upfront, investing in higher-quality materials can lead to long-term savings. Cheaper materials often require more frequent replacements or repairs, finally costing you more over time.


Think about the timeframe on your roofing project, as this will also influence your choice. Some materials are quicker to put in than others, relying on the complexity of the design. This can affect your home’s livability through the installation course of. Understanding the timeline might help you plan accordingly, minimizing disruptions to your beloved ones routine.

How do I determine the lifespan of various roofing materials?

Research the typical lifespan of assorted roofing materials before making a choice. For occasion, asphalt shingles usually last 15-30 years, while metal roofs can last 40+ years. This factor can influence both maintenance prices and long-term funding.




What are the maintenance necessities for various roofing styles?


Maintenance varies broadly among roofing types. For occasion, wooden shakes could require common therapy to forestall rot, whereas metal roofs generally require much less repairs. Understanding these requirements will allow you to choose a mode that fits your lifestyle.
